If the newborn head was adult-sized, it could not pass through birth canal. Humans need to adapt to wide range of environments throughout life span and the brain must be able to develop to meet these challenges. (if was wired fully would be too unchangeable, wouldn"t be able to adapt) The brain wires" mostly after birth in response to the environment: fivefold increase in dendrites that occurs in the first 2-years. But it"s temporary. : enables neurons to connect and communicate with other neurons. (there are connections, soon after too many conections, this is followed by pruning where unused neurons and misconnected dendrites die. More efficient neural communication: fragile x syndrome failure to prune. Infancy: of development that begins at birth and lasts between 18 and 24 months. Newborns have poor sight, but habituate to visual stimuli. Newborns can mimic facial expressions within the first hour of life.
